在数字浪潮席卷全球的今天,以太坊(Ethereum)无疑是区块链领域最耀眼的明星之一,它不仅仅是一种加密货币,更是一个全球性的、去中心化的应用平台,被誉为“世界计算机”,支撑这台“世界计算机”高效运转的,并非我们传统意义上的CPU或GPU,而是两个看似专业、实则至关重要的概念:核心(Core)与显存(VRAM),它们如同这台机器的“心脏”与“大脑”,共同决定了以太坊网络的性能、安全与未来。
核心:以太坊虚拟机的引擎
当我们谈论以太坊的“核心”时,我们实际上指向的是其最根本的技术基石——以太坊虚拟机(Ethereum Virtua
EVM是以太坊的“执行引擎”,是一个图灵完备的虚拟机,这意味着它可以执行任何复杂的计算任务,只要给它足够的时间和资源,每一个智能合约的部署、每一次代币的转移、每一个去中心化应用(DApp)的交互,最终都会被编译成EVM能够理解的指令,并在全球成千上万的节点上被执行。
核心的重要性体现在:
- 确定性: EVM的设计确保了,无论在哪个节点上执行,只要输入数据相同,输出结果就完全相同,这是以太坊去中心化信任的基石,如果每个节点的计算结果都不同,单一事实来源”将不复存在,整个网络也将陷入混乱。
- 安全性: 通过智能合约,复杂的逻辑和资产可以被编码在区块链上,自动执行,无需信任第三方,EVM为这些代码提供了一个安全、隔离的运行环境,防止恶意代码破坏整个网络。
- 可编程性: EVM赋予了以太坊无限的想象空间,从DeFi(去中心化金融)、NFT(非同质化代币)到DAO(去中心化自治组织),所有这些创新都源于开发者可以在EVM上自由地编写和部署代码。
可以说,EVM是以太坊的“灵魂”,是驱动整个网络运行的核心逻辑,没有EVM,以太坊将只是一个简单的支付系统,而无法承载构建去中心化互联网的宏伟愿景。
显存:智能合约的“工作台”
如果说EVM是引擎,那么显存(VRAM, Video RAM)就是为这台引擎提供燃料和操作空间的“工作台”或“车间”,在以太坊的早期,矿工(现在是验证者)使用GPU(图形处理器)来执行计算和打包区块,GPU拥有大量的显存,这是一种高速的、专门为图形处理设计的内存。
显存的重要性体现在:
- 缓存智能合约状态: 在执行一个复杂的智能合约时,需要频繁地读取和写入数据,这些数据,如合约的变量、存储的账户信息等,会被临时加载到速度极快的显存中,这使得GPU可以像在高速工作台上一样,快速抓取和处理所需材料,极大地提升了计算效率,如果数据全部从速度慢得多的系统内存或硬盘中读取,计算速度将大打折扣。
- 处理大型数据集: 许多高级应用,如某些DeFi协议中的复杂算法或大规模数据NFT,需要处理庞大的数据集,充足的显存空间使得GPU能够一次性容纳这些数据,进行高效运算,避免了因数据量过大而导致的计算瓶颈或失败。
- 挖矿/验证性能的关键: 在“工作量证明”(PoW)时代,显存大小是衡量GPU挖矿性能的核心指标之一,拥有更大显存的GPU,能够缓存更多的交易数据,从而在竞争中胜出,获得出块权,虽然以太坊已转向“权益证明”(PoS),但验证节点依然需要高效处理网络中的海量交易,显存的作用依然举足轻重。
简而言之,显存的大小和速度,直接决定了单个节点处理以太坊网络任务的能力,它是连接EVM“核心逻辑”与物理硬件“计算能力”之间不可或缺的桥梁。
核心、显存与以太坊的共生演进
“核心”与“显存”的关系,是软件与硬件、逻辑与物理的完美协同,以太坊的“核心”(EVM)定义了“做什么”,而GPU的“显存”则决定了“能做多快、做多好”。
随着以太坊网络的发展,这对关系也在不断演进:
- 从PoW到PoS: 以太坊“合并”(The Merge)的完成,标志着网络从依赖计算算力的PoW转向了依赖质押和验证的PoS,虽然验证过程不再需要像挖矿那样极致的算力,但对硬件的要求并未消失,一个强大的“核心”(高效的验证客户端)和充足的“显存”(用于快速同步和处理状态)依然是成为一名可靠验证者的基础。
- 分片技术的未来: 以太坊的下一步重大升级是“分片”(Sharding),通过将网络分割成多条并行的“数据链”,以太坊将极大地提升交易处理能力,这一变革对“核心”和“显存”都提出了新的要求,每个分片都需要独立的EVM实例来处理交易,而验证者则需要能够同时处理多个分片信息的强大硬件,其中显存的作用将更加关键,因为它需要缓存来自不同分片的数据。
以太坊的成功,是一场深刻的技术革命,在这场革命中,“核心”(以太坊虚拟机)是思想的源泉,是定义规则与逻辑的大脑;而“显存”(硬件资源)是实现的基石,是支撑这些思想高速运转的强大心脏,二者缺一不可,共同构成了这台“世界计算机”的动力核心。
展望未来,随着以太坊不断向着更高性能、更强安全性和更广泛应用迈进,理解并优化这对“核心”与“显存”的关系,将继续是开发者、验证者和整个社区面临的核心课题,正是这种软硬件的协同进化,正在一步步将去中心化的未来蓝图,变为触手可及的现实。